I found this amusing...Chicago author Bill Hillmann, who co-wrote a book called "How to Survive the Running of the Bulls", was gored yesterday during the Running of the Bulls in Pamplona, Spain. The 32 year-old tripped and fell when a bull gored him in his right thigh. The black bull weighed 1,300 pounds.
